Cottage Grove Bank Building offers free workspace for evacuees

COTTAGE GROVE — The Bank Building in downtown Cottage Grove is offering free office workspace for those recently evacuated from their homes or have lost power as a result of Oregon’s unprecedented wildfires. 

During this crisis, the Bank Building Offices – located at 609 E. Main Street in downtown Cottage Grove – is offering free, open workspace that includes free Internet, Wi-Fi, scanning, faxing, coffee, tea, and hot water. Free workspace is limited and available on a first-come, first-serve basis.

 Constructed in 1904, the newly renovated Bank Building Offices opened July 1. The building was recently transformed into a downtown treasure and business hub for Cottage Grove. It features apartments upstairs and shared office space downstairs, in addition to Bartolotti’s Pizza & Pasta, Edward Jones, and Juanita’s Latina Store.
